West Indian vs Immigrants from Central America Female Unemployment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 253,607,291 people shows a mild negative correlation between the proportion of West Indians and unemploymnet rate among females in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.346 and weighted average of 6.1%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 528,420,242 people shows a substantial positive corre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from Central America and unemploymnet rate among females in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.533 and weighted average of 6.2%, a difference of 1.7%.
